As the telecommunication evolved very fast, from the early age of the Analog Voice network to the Digit Voice network, then went into H.323 VoIP network and SIP VoIP network etc, different technical telecommunication network platform emerged continually. So, the interoperation between those platforms comes to be a big problem we must face. Network Gateway is such a switch center bringing those different platforms together, mainly includes the switch of Signal and Content (Voice, video etc.). Signal is the control commands which are sent between those network endpoints for the purpose of setting up and managing the communication. Because the control commands are so different in different platform, the signal transform plays the key role in the implementation of network gateway. This thesis will introduce such of a signal transform system connecting the SIP VoIP telecommunication network and the traditional ISDN network. This transform plan's design adopts two concepts: business abstract and modularization. Business abstract means that all the business logics in different network platform are abstracted to a common business logic set, and those different network platforms will be an implementation of the subset of that common abstract business logic set. Modularization means loose coupling will be kept between the implementation of different platform, also between different business processes, all these things will become different separated modules.At the chapter 5, the advanced topics of implementation will be discussed; those are extensible, simultaneousness, stable.
